preguntaron
asked, they asked
Verb preguntaron
-
Third-person plural (ellos, ellas, also used with ustedes) preterite indicative form of preguntar.
-
(used formally in Spain) Second-person plural preterite indicative form of preguntar.

Cuando le preguntaron qué era más importante aprender, él dijo "a no olvidar lo que has aprendido".
When asked what learning was the most necessary, he said, "Not to unlearn what you have learned."
-
Ellos preguntaron por mi padre.
They asked after my father.
-
Los estudiantes preguntaron cuestiones una tras otra.
The students asked questions one after another.
-
Nos preguntaron si sabíamos cuándo comenzaba la película.
They asked us if we knew when the movie started.
-
Le preguntaron.
They asked him.
-
Me preguntaron, "¿Estás bien, muchacho?". Yo respondí, "Estoy bien."
I was asked, "You OK, kid?". I replied, "Fine."
-
Ellos le preguntaron a Mary por qué lloraba.
They asked Mary why she was crying.
